bbp style pack <= 6.4.5 - Authenticated (Subscriber+) Stored Cross-Site Scripting via Topic Form Additional Fields
Description

The bbp Style Pack plugin for WordPress is vulnerable to Stored Cross-Site Scripting in versions up to, and including, 6.4.5 via the Topic Form Additional Fields feature. This is due to insufficient input sanitization in bsp_topic_fields_form_save() (which writes $_POST['bsp_topic_fields_label{n}'] directly to post meta via update_post_meta() with no filtering) and missing output escaping in bsp_topic_content_append_topic_fields() (which concatenates the stored meta value into an HTML <span> and echoes it via apply_filters/echo without esc_html()). This makes it possible for authenticated attackers, with Subscriber-level access and above (who have bbPress topic-creation privileges), to inject arbitrary web scripts in pages that will execute whenever a user accesses an injected page, including unauthenticated visitors.

Solution
Update the bbp Style Pack plugin to a patched version to fix stored XSS.
  • Update the bbp Style Pack plugin.
  • Verify that topic form additional fields are sanitized.
  • Ensure all output from stored data is escaped.
